新手入门时遇到的难题:oracle数据库默认用户名和密码你了解吗?

新手入门时遇到的难题:oracle数据库默认用户名和密码你了解吗? 一

Oracle数据库在企业级应用中非常常见,尤其是大型系统的后端。对于刚接触数据库的新手来说,了解Oracle数据库默认用户名和密码是一个重要而关键的步骤,以确保他们能够顺利登录并进行后续的开发和管理。

默认用户名和密码

Oracle数据库的默认用户名通常是 “SYS” 和 “SYSTEM”,这两个用户是数据库管理员,它们拥有最高的权限。在初次安装Oracle数据库时,系统会要求设置这些用户的密码, 有些新手在安装过程中可能会选择使用默认的密码。在真实的环境中,使用默认密码会面临严重的安全问题。

  • SYS 用户:拥有所有数据库对象的完全访问权限,通常用于管理数据库的操作。
  • SYSTEM 用户:用于创造和管理数据库用户,修改数据库配置等。
  • 常见的安全隐患

    使用默认用户名和密码存在几个安全隐患,要尽量避免。

  • 被攻击者轻易访问:黑客可以使用常见的默认用户名和密码以访问数据库。
  • 数据泄露风险:轻易获得的登录信息可能导致敏感数据被未授权人员获取。
  • 规避法律责任:若因安全问题造成数据泄露,使用默认密码的个人或公司可能面临法律责任。
  • 为了避免这些问题,新手在建立数据库后,应该立即更改这两个用户的密码,并确保其他用户的权限设置合理。

    最佳实践

    为了确保Oracle数据库的安全性,新手可以遵循以下最佳实践:

  • 及时更新密码:安装完成后,应立即更改默认用户名的密码,避免使用弱密码。
  • 创建特定权限的用户:根据不同的应用场景,创建具体的用户,并为其设置最小权限,从而最小化安全风险。
  • 定期审查用户权限:定期检查用户的权限设置,以防过期的或不必要的用户拥有访问权限。
  • 使用复杂密码:对于所有数据库用户,确保采用较为复杂的密码,包括字母、数字和特殊字符。
  • 用户权限管理

    权限管理在Oracle数据库中至关重要,合理配置用户权限可以有效降低风险。可以创建如下表格来帮助更好地理解不同用户的权限设置:

    用户名 权限级别 用途 默认密码 安全
    SYS 超级用户 数据库全权管理 初始安装时设置 需尽快更改
    SYSTEM 管理员 用户管理与配置 初始安装时设置 需尽快更改

    通过以上信息,新手在使用Oracle数据库时能够更有效地管理默认用户及其密码,尽量降低安全隐患。掌握这一技巧后,不论是办公、学习还是开发,都将顺利进行。


    确认数据库用户权限的步骤实际上并不复杂。 你可以使用一些查询命令直接查看当前用户的权限。这类查询能够帮助你清楚地了解当前用户所拥有的系统权限和角色。比如,你可以执行命令SELECT FROM user_sys_privs;。这个命令会返回所有当前用户在系统中被分配的特权,这样你就能看到哪些操作是被允许的,哪些是被限制的。

    市面上也有许多管理工具可以帮助你更方便地检查和管理用户权限。这些工具通常提供图形化的界面,让权限配置变得更加直观。在这些工具中,你可以轻松查看用户的权限设置,甚至可以修改或撤销不必要的权限。这样做不仅让管理变得简单,更能有效提升整个数据库系统的安全性。个性化地管理用户权限,能够确保只有合适的人能够访问特定的数据和功能。在复杂的数据库环境中,这种做法也是确保系统安全和操作合规的重要措施。


    常见问题解答

    什么是Oracle数据库的默认用户名和密码?

    Oracle数据库的默认用户名通常是 “SYS” 和 “SYSTEM”。SYS用户负责管理数据库,而SYSTEM用户则用于创建和管理其他用户及其权限。

    为什么不应该使用默认密码?

    使用默认密码会让数据库易受到攻击,黑客可以通过常见的用户名和密码组合轻易访问数据库,从而带来数据泄露和安全隐患。

    如何更改Oracle数据库的默认密码?

    要更改Oracle数据库的默认密码,可以使用SQL命令,如ALTER USER SYS IDENTIFIED BY 新密码;,以SYS用户为例。务必确保在数据库安装后立即进行密码更改。

    如何确认我的数据库用户权限是否正确?

    可以通过查询用户权限或使用管理工具来检查权限配置。可以执行命令SELECT FROM user_sys_privs;以查看当前用户的系统权限。

    如果忘记了Oracle数据库的密码,我该怎么办?

    如果忘记了密码,可以尝试以SYSDBA身份登录,使用ALTER USER 用户名 IDENTIFIED BY 新密码;命令重置密码。如果无法登录,请参考Oracle文档进行相关救援操作。

    © 版权声明
    THE END
    喜欢就支持一下吧
    点赞7 分享
    评论 抢沙发

    请登录后发表评论

      暂无评论内容